Two major energy suppliers, Octopus Energy and OVO, will distribute tens of thousands of complimentary electric blankets to eligible households facing financial hardship in 2025. Electric blankets cost approximately 2-4p per hour to operate and allow one person to stay warm without heating an entire property. Octopus Energy reports customers who previously received blankets saved 10-20 percent on energy bills and that use of the blankets can save up to 300. Priority will go to elderly residents, people with mobility restrictions, and those with health conditions sensitive to cold. Applicants must apply and meet eligibility criteria.
